OVERVIEW OF THE COMPANY

Fox TV Stations

FOX Television Stations owns and operates 29 full power broadcast television stations in the U.S. These include stations located in 14 of the top 15 largest designated market areas, or DMAs, and duopolies in 11 DMAs, including the three largest DMAs (New York, Los Angeles and Chicago). Of these stations, 18 are affiliated with the FOX Network. In addition to distributing sports, entertainment and syndicated content, our television stations collectively produce approximately 1,200 hours of local news every week. These stations leverage viewer, distributor and advertiser demand for the FOX Network’s national content.

JOB DESCRIPTION

FOX Chicago is seeking a Multimedia Producer to own the lifecycle of our Creative Services Department's digital video production projects and contribute to the Station's digital audience engagement marketing strategy. The Multimedia Producer will be responsible for planning, producing, editing, and optimizing digital shows, documentaries, and segments for our connected TV (CTV app), website, YouTube, TikTok, and other social media platforms. You may find yourself directing a live show on Digital or shooting and editing a documentary.

You will also play a significant role in our digital audience engagement, helping to grow our brand and promote various shows and on-air.

Do you love creating compelling talent on social media and being on the cusp of emerging trends? When it comes to data, you are excited to spot trends and use it to improve the digital content and brand experience to grow the audience.

The Multimedia Producer works with the Creative Department and the FOX Chicago Digital Team to produce a variety of content and campaigns, ranging from digital and social content promoting the Station’s talent, brand, and products to producing daily live shows, specials and monthly shows for CTV. This position reports to the FOX Chicago VP, Programming & Development. The role requires a creative self-starter with deep understanding of digital and social media content marketing and longform video production with a knack for tracking and analyzing audience data to adjust and execute strategies, keeping audience engagement, brand pillars, and an exceptional user experience top of mind.
